Voluntary Designation of Homestead The Edinburg Texas Voluntary Designation of Homestead is a legal process that allows homeowners in Edinburg, Texas, to declare their residential property as a homestead. This designation offers various benefits and protections to homeowners, ensuring the safeguarding of their property and certain legal rights. Under Texas law, the Voluntary Designation of Homestead is available to any homeowner who uses their property as their primary residence. By filing this designation, homeowners make it clear that the property is their homestead, which grants them certain legal and financial advantages. One significant benefit of this designation is the protection provided against creditors. When a property is designated as a homestead, it becomes exempt from seizure or forced sale by most creditors, offering homeowners a sense of security in times of financial turmoil. This protection extends to unsecured debts, such as credit card debt, medical bills, and personal loans. Moreover, the designation of homestead also reduces property tax liability. By declaring a property as a homestead, homeowners can claim exemptions on a portion of their property's assessed value and thus enjoy reduced property tax bills. This financial relief can significantly contribute to the affordability and sustainability of homeownership in Edinburg, Texas. Another important aspect of the Edinburg Texas Voluntary Designation of Homestead is its contribution to a homeowner's eligibility for certain local tax relief programs. The designation may qualify homeowners for additional property tax exemptions specifically designed for senior citizens, disabled individuals, veterans, or low-income households. These programs vary, providing targeted support to those who may benefit most. It is also worth mentioning that the Voluntary Designation of Homestead encompasses two main types: urban and rural homesteads. Urban homesteads refer to properties located within city limits, while rural homesteads are situated outside the city limits on larger lots or agricultural land. Both designations offer the same core benefits and protections, with variations depending on the location and applicable local regulations. In order to initiate the process of obtaining the Edinburg Texas Voluntary Designation of Homestead, homeowners must file the necessary documentation with the county appraisal district or the tax assessor's office. These documents typically include the Homestead Exemption Application, provided by the appraisal district, along with supporting evidence such as proof of residency, identification, and ownership.
